The 31st edition of BioCultura Barcelona will take place from 29 May -1 June 2025 at La Farga de L'Hopitalet, bringing together over 400 exhibitors and an expected 50,000 visitors. As one of the largest fairs in Spain dedicated to organic products and responsible consumption, the event will showcase a wide range of sectors including organic food, sustainable fashion, eco-friendly cosmetics, wellness, and ethical finance. It is an important meeting point for businesses, NGOs, cooperatives, and consumers who are actively engaged in sustainable and socially inclusive living.

The event also features over 400 parallel activities such as workshops, talks, and demos covering health, climate action, and regenerative practices, creating opportunities for learning, dialogue, and collaboration. Visitors can explore curated exhibitions on zero waste lifestyles, local economies, and eco-innovation.

BioCultura Barcelona 2025 will be held at La Farga de L'Hopitalet, an iconic venue easily accessible via public transport. Opening hours are Thursday to Saturday: 10:00-20:00 CEST and Sunday: 10:00-19:00 CEST. Tickets can be booked online in advance or purchased at the venue.
